now, as far as your current engine being gauranteed 350 HP, based on what specs you gave me,n ot a chance, so punched it up in DD2000 just to see what it said.Hell maybe I was wrong LOL. heres what I came up with.
peak HP 294@4500 RPMS
peak TQ 370@3000 RPMS
after switching cam, intake carb, & heads( by the way, 76cc to 64cc gets you 10.7:1).
peak HP 346@5500 RPMs
peak TQ 382 @4000 RPMs
Those numbers are assuming you have headers & a decent exhaust system, you didnt say.
You said it has Performer intake now, & plan to change to an Air Gap, I assume you mean th RPM AIr Gap, its confusing, but you can by the AirGap in Performer & Performer RPM.
If that was the combo I was going to use, I think Id just keep the regular performer on it, & either keep the 600 cfm carb & add a 1" open spacer, or buy a Demon 625 for it. John
